It is possible to make the 45 version from the vinyl LP version. Although I don't have the "oblivion" CD. We can probably make the 45 version adding a part of the full length CD version. it seems that "oblivion" CD is deficient in the part from 4:10 to 4:13 on the LP.

"How to make the 45 version from the LP"
Reduce the intro of only the keyboard and drums (about 18 seconds) to half. Delete from 4:13 (after the drums beat) till the end on the LP. Fade out from 3:45 on the 45.
